Guy Cihi writes open letter about Silent Hill HD Collection’s voice recasting

Guy Cihi, the original voice and motion capture actor for James Sutherland in Silent Hill 2, has written an open letter to Konami Digital Entertainment on his Facebook page regarding the voice-acting recasting controversy in Silent Hill HD Collection.

"The only way to do this appears to be for me to relinquish all my rights to Konami and so I hereby completely waive all rights to my motion capture and vocal performances in the Silent Hill 2 production without demand for additional consideration. Have your lawyer send me the proper documents required so that we can put this fiasco behind us."
